Предмет: Информатика, автор: golovac447

СРОЧНО!!!! PYTHON!!!!
1)Написати процедуру Minmax(A, B), яка записує у змінну A найменше із значень A та B, а в змінну B — найбільше із цих значень (A іB— цілі параметри, що є одночасно вхідними та вихідними). Використовуючи чотири виклики процедури знайти найменше та найбільше із чисел A,B,C,D

2)Написати процедуру SumDigit(N,S), яка знаходить суму цифр S цілого числа N (N - вхідний, S — вихідний параметр). Знайдіть суму цифр для кожного із K даних чисел.
3) Для заданих чисел знайти кількість тих з них, які мають парну суму цифр.

Формат вхідних даних:
Перший рядок вхідного потоку містить ціле NN (1≤N≤1000) – кількість чисел. У наступному рядку знаходяться самі додатні цілі числа, що не більші 10
Формат вихідних даних:
У вихідний потік вивести кількість чисел, які мають парну суму цифр
Вхідні дані:
5
5 11 9 8 121
Вихідні дані :
3

Приложения:

Ответы

Автор ответа: reyzuu
2

Объяснение:

1)

a,b,c,d=map(int,input().split())

e=[a,b,c,d]

mi=min(e)

ma=max(e)

print(mi,ma)

2)

a=int(input('Кол-во чисел: '))

s=0

for i in range(a):

   b=int(input('Введите число: '))

   while b!=0:

       d=b % 10

       s+=d

       b=b//10

   print(s)

   s=0

3)

a=int(input('Кол-во чисел: '))

s=0

s1=0

for i in range(a):

   b=int(input('Введите число: '))

   while b!=0:

       d=b % 10

       s+=d

       b=b//10

       if s%2==0:

           s1+=1

   s=0

print(s1)


golovac447: Большое спасибо)
reyzuu: отметьте как лучшее,пожалуйста
Похожие вопросы
Предмет: Химия, автор: alanana23